WebJun 27, 2024 · Typically, when a Medi-Cal recipient dies, the Medi-Cal office in the county where the decedent resides is notified and that office notifies the Department of Health Services in Sacramento. Then benefits are terminated. However, state law also requires that the beneficiary’s estate independently notify the California Department of Health Services. Acceptable documentation includes an original death certificate, a certified copy of the death certificate, or an accurate and complete photocopy of one of those documents.
